On-site, engineers utilize SupAnchor's self drilling anchor bolts to secure excavation faces and prevent collapses. The construction scene depicted shows workers installing hollow bar anchors with integrated drill-and-grout technology, allowing simultaneous drilling and grouting for rapid installation. This method addresses site-specific issues such as variable soil density and water ingress, enhancing ground stabilization.
Key product parameters, derived from SupAnchor's specifications, include:
| Parameter | Value | Application Benefit |
|---|---|---|
| Tensile Strength | Up to 600 MPa | Withstands high loads in unstable rock formations |
| Diameter | 25-50 mm | Adapts to various borehole sizes for precise reinforcement |
| Length | Up to 12 meters | Provides deep anchorage in slope stabilization and retaining walls |
| Corrosion Protection | Hot-dip galvanized or epoxy coated | Ensures durability in moist environments, critical for underground mining and civil engineering |
